Tan 7° tan23° tan60° tan67° tan83°= √3

Solution verified Verified by Toppr To evaluate, tan7 ∘ tan23 ∘ tan60 ∘ tan67 ∘ tan83 ∘ We know that, tan(90−θ)=cotθ and cotθ= tanθ 1 ​ tan7 ∘ =tan(90 ∘ −83 ∘ )=cot83 ∘ tan23 ∘ =tan(90 ∘ −67 ∘ )=cot67 ∘ ∴tan7 ∘ tan23 ∘ tan60 ∘ tan67 ∘ tan83 ∘ =cot83 ∘ cot67 ∘ tan60 ∘ tan67 ∘ tan83 ∘ = tan83 ∘ 1 ​ tan67 ∘ 1 ​ tan60 ∘ tan67 ∘ tan83 ∘ = tan83 ∘ tan67 ∘ tan60 ∘ tan67 ∘ tan83 ∘ ​ =tan60 ∘ = 3 ​ Solve any question of Introduction to Trigonometry with:-
